Description
Unauthenticated remote attackers can access the system through the LoadMaster management interface, enabling arbitrary system command execution.

3. Affected Systems and Software Versions
Affected Systems:
- Progress Kemp LoadMaster devices running vulnerable versions of the LoadMaster OS (LMOS).
Software Versions:
- Specific versions affected include LMOS 7.2.59, 7.2.54, 8.7.2.48, and 10.

6. Technical Details for Security Professionals
Vulnerability Details:
- Command Injection Point: The vulnerability exists in the management interface, where user inputs are not properly sanitized, allowing for command injection.
- Exploitation Steps:
- Identify the LoadMaster management interface.
- Craft a malicious input that includes system commands.
- Submit the input through the management interface.
- The system executes the injected commands, leading to arbitrary code execution.
